Erectile Dysfunction & Men’s Sexual Health | Feed Drop Featuring Eve
Erectile dysfunction (ED) is one of the most common sexuality health concerns and can also signal underlying cardiovascular, hormonal, or metabolic issues. In this Feed Drop of the Communicate & Connect Podcast, Eve Hall speaks with host Dr. Elizabeth Polinsky about ED, pelvic floor health, intimacy, communication, and evidence-based treatment options that support both sexual function and relationship connection.
They explore physical vs psychological causes, blood flow and cardiovascular health, morning erections as a health marker, pelvic floor physical therapy, lifestyle and nutrition support, and how couples can communicate about sexual challenges without shame. The conversation highlights that intimacy extends beyond penetration and that early support matters.
